Just don't be fooled into thinking that the rusty mess caused by galvanic corrosion is the cause of your evaporator coil leaks. That rusty steel may actually be protecting the copper more than harming it. Some companies make sacrificial anodes that attach to the suction to help further protect the system from corrosion.

The evaporator is one of the two coils in a split air conditioner. The evaporator coil is located indoors, while the other coil, the condenser, is located outdoors. The primary purpose of the evaporator coil is to remove heat and moisture from the indoor air as it passes over the coil. The evaporator coil contains refrigerant, which helps to ... An A-coil evaporator style is the most common design of evaporator coil in HVAC systems. Shaped like a tent—or the letter “A”—this type of coil is chosen for its space-efficient design, optimizing heat exchange and enabling compact installation. A dirty evaporator coil can cause your air conditioner to stop working entirely. This occurs when condensation forms on the dirt and then freezes while the air conditioner is running. Most evaporator coils consist of either an N- or A-shaped design. A-coils are more common than N-coils. They are used in more heating, ventilation and cooling (HVAC) systems than N-coils. One of the main advantages of choosing an A-coil is drainage. They can last 10 to 15 years or as long as the AC unit ... There are two common causes of broken air conditioner evaporator coils. First, the system’s vibration may slowly crack the joints in the tubing. These cracks allow refrigerant to escape. Second, volatile organic compounds found in our homes react with condensation and create formic acid. This acid erodes the coils, and eventually, the coils ...
